Abstract

This study aims to develop critical thinking skills and student learning outcomes on the subject of Natural Resources Utilization through Project-Based Learning. The research method used in this research is Classroom Action Research. The subjects of this study were the fourth grade students of SD IT Insan Rabbani for the 2018/2019 academic year, totaling 29 students. Students consist of 15 male students and 14 female students. The instruments used in this study were learning outcomes tests, critical thinking skills tests, and observation sheets. The results showed that the critical thinking skills and learning outcomes of elementary school students for grade IV on the material of the relationship between economic activities and the use of natural resources through project-based learning increased in each cycle. The results of student learning completeness in the pre-cycle are 41.38%. Through the application of project-based learning, student learning outcomes have increased in each cycle, namely 48.28% in the first cycle, the second cycle, which is 72.41% and 86.21% in the third cycle. Based on the results of these studies, it can be concluded that critical thinking skills and learning outcomes of SD IT Insan Rabbani Class IV students on the subject of Relationships between Economic Activities and Utilization of Natural Resources have increased through Project-Based Learning. Thus, the researcher recommends Project-Based Learning as an alternative in improving critical thinking skills in social studies learning material on the relationship between economic activities and the use of natural resources.
